Mitsuya Hongu is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Molecular Biology and Oncology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Mitsuya Hongu has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 730 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Organic Chemistry, 7 papers in Molecular Biology and 4 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Mitsuya Hongu’s work include Drug Transport and Resistance Mechanisms (4 papers), Diabetes Treatment and Management (4 papers) and Synthesis and Reactions of Organic Compounds (2 papers). Mitsuya Hongu is often cited by papers focused on Drug Transport and Resistance Mechanisms (4 papers), Diabetes Treatment and Management (4 papers) and Synthesis and Reactions of Organic Compounds (2 papers). Mitsuya Hongu coll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. Mitsuya Hongu's co-authors include Kenji Tsujihara, Kunio SAITO, Mamoru Matsumoto, Masako Nakagawa and Tomohiko Kawate and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Medicinal Chemistry, Tetrahedron and Tetrahedron Letters.
